Beyond convenience, PV jumpers and adapters offer several crucial benefits: Safety: Standardized connectors ensure secure and reliable connections, minimizing the risk of electrical hazards. Efficiency: Optimized connections minimize power loss and ensure maximum power. . PV Adapters: These act as intermediaries, seamlessly connecting panels with different connector types to a compatible system. They eliminate the need for complex rewiring and ensure system compatibility. KPIs are vital metrics to evaluate the technical performance, economic sustainability, and environmental impact of PV systems. From investors and asset managers to operation and maintenance (O&M) providers, stakeholders rely on KPIs to assess system reliability, guide decision-making, and analyze. .
